This research aims to identify the influence of entrepreneurial knowledge, financial literacy, and motivation on students' entrepreneurial intentions at the Faculty of Economics and Business, Bung Hatta University. By using a data collection method by distributing questionnaires directly. The objects of this research were students at the Faculty of Economics and Business, Bung Hatta University, with a total sample of 105 people consisting of students majoring in accounting, management and development economics, which were processed with the help of the SE/17 statistical analysis tool. Based on the research results, it is known that the entrepreneurial knowledge variable has a positive effect on entrepreneurial intentions and the financial literacy variable has a positive effect on entrepreneurial intentions, while the motivation variable has no effect on the entrepreneurial intentions of students at the Faculty of Economics and Business, Bung Hatta University.
